Killing Floor 2 is a first-person shooter video game developed and published by Tripwire Interactive, with later support from Saber Interactive. It is a sequel to 2009's Killing Floor . An early access version of the game was released for Microsoft Windows in April 2015, and the game was released in November 2016 for Windows and PlayStation 4 ...

Killing Floor is a first-person shooter with two game modes: Killing Floor and Objective.In Killing Floor mode, the player fights waves of zombie-like specimens - or ZEDs - with each wave becoming successively more difficult, until it concludes with a battle against a "boss" specimen called the Patriarch. Tripwire's second game, Killing Floor, was released on May 14, 2009. Like Red Orchestra , this game also began development as a mod for Unreal Tournament 2004 , later becoming a standalone retail title. [ 3 ]
